About this work

A ruin with arches and a tower by the water. Right: a pedestrian and a man on a donkey. Left in the foreground, three figures and goats. Print forming part of a series of Roman ruins and coastal landscapes after prints by Willem van Nieulandt. This series is a copy of the series made by Claes Jansz Visscher after Van Nieulandt.
